Chocolate Crunch Bars from Scratch

These Homemade Crunch Bars are a cleaner, better-for-you take on the classic candy bar everyone loves. A rich blend of dark chocolate, creamy peanut butter, and maple syrup creates a smooth, fudge-like coating that clings perfectly to every bite of crispy rice cereal. Unlike store-bought versions, these bars skip the artificial ingredients and corn syrup while still delivering that signature crunch and satisfying snap.

Homemade Crunch Bars

Ingredients

THE CRUNCH
Crispy rice cereal – 3 cups

THE FUDGE BASE
Chocolate chips – 1½ cups
Peanut butter (or nut/seed butter) – 1 cup
Maple syrup – ½ cup
Coconut oil (or grass-fed butter) – ¼ cup

How To Make Homemade Crunch Bars

Step 1: Prepare the Pan
Line an 8×8-inch baking dish (or a similar-sized pan) with parchment paper, leaving extra hanging over the sides for easy removal later.

Step 2: Add the Cereal
Place the crispy rice cereal into a large mixing bowl and set aside.

Step 3: Melt the Fudge Base
In a microwave-safe bowl or small saucepan over low heat, combine the chocolate chips, peanut butter, maple syrup, and coconut oil. Heat gently, stirring often, until fully melted and smooth. Whisk until glossy and evenly blended.

Step 4: Coat the Cereal
Pour the warm chocolate mixture over the cereal. Gently fold until every piece is evenly coated and glossy.

Step 5: Press and Chill
Transfer the mixture into the prepared pan. Press firmly into an even layer using the back of a spoon or parchment paper. Refrigerate for at least 1 hour, or until fully set.

Step 6: Slice and Enjoy
Lift the bars out using the parchment paper and cut into squares or bars. Store in the refrigerator to keep them firm and crunchy.
